Le Dr. Weld


This summer I spent a month in Toulouse in the south of France which has planted in me a deep-seated interest in the French culture and language.  So, as I was browsing the lovely YouTube, I put in a search for “soudage” – “welding” in French, and this popped up.

Dr. Weld?  Seriously?

Evidently this persona of the internet likes to sing about current events, with a welding helmet on, in what appears to be his own welding shop.

This particular video is about his feelings on telemarketing, but there are many more…


Leave a Reply

Your email address will not be published. Required fields are marked *